About
Yangmei (bay berry) fruit juice, rich in antioxidants and vitamins that support skin vitality.
Myrica rubra fruit juice is expressed from a Myricaceae shrub cultivated in China. The fruit is exceptionally rich in myricetin glycosides and anthocyanins. Not regulated under EU Cosmetics Regulation; widely consumed as food with no safety concerns. No Cosing restrictions for this ingredient type.
Skin benefits
- Very high antioxidant capacity from myricetin
- Anti-inflammatory activity
- Anthocyanin support for skin repair
- Potentially anti-aging due to free-radical scavenging
